About Creditcoin
Creditcoin is a project developed by a team based in the United States, Canada, South Korea, Nigeria, and Estonia. Its goal is to address the lack of credit systems for the unbanked in emerging markets. Individuals who are unable to access traditional banking services often have to rely on non-banking sources for loans. However, banks do not accept credit records from these non-banking institutions because they cannot verify the reliability of the data. Creditcoin aims to solve this issue by documenting credit transaction history transparently on a public blockchain, providing a trustworthy record that banks can rely on.
